5.3.5  Rejecting sea clutter (Sea) 
 
 
Never set the sea clutter suppression function before rejecting all the sea 
clutters at close range. Detection of not only echoes from the wave and 
so on but also targets such as other ships or dangerous objects may be 
suppressed. 
When using the sea clutter suppression function, make sure to choose 
the most appropriate setting for suppression. 
 
Memo 
Remove images by sea clutter by using the sea clutter suppression function. 
When using the sea clutter suppression function, make the optimum setting, giving considerating 
to the setting described in "5.3.7 Adjusting to optimal images (Selection of observation scenes)". 
 
1  Drag the [Sea] (sea clutter adjustment) slider dial in Radar signal information, turn the 
trackball, and adjust the amount of images by sea clutter displayed on the screen so 
as to make display easy to observe. 
 
 
 
Moving the slider to the right decreases the amount of images by sea clutter. 
Moving the slider to the left increases the amount of images by sea clutter. 
The current level of sea clutter suppression is indicated by the bar and a numeric value. 
 
 
 
[Points on adjustments] 
The sea clutter suppression function decreases the amount of images by sea clutter by lowering 
reception gain at close range. When reception gain is lowered, the effectiveness of sea clutter 
suppression increases; however, if excessive effect is applied, please note that targets having weak 
signal strength such as buoys and small ships will disappear.
